Простой способ применения вычисляемых / встроенных стилей для HTML? - PullRequest
1 голос
/ 20 сентября 2010

Действительно раздражающая ситуация, и, возможно, есть более простое решение ... но у меня в основном простая таблица, которую я стилизовал в общем формате:

<style type="text/css">
  table.master_table {
    ... global table styling
  }
  .master_table td {
    ... master table td styling
  } 
  .master_table td.dv {
    ... td dv style
  }
  .. more styling
</style>

<table class="master_table">
  <tbody>
 <tr>
   <td class="dv">
     .. nothing special
 </tr>
  </tbody>
</table>

Теперь проблема в том, что сервер не поддерживаетэлемент "style", поэтому мне нужно вручную применить стиль к каждому уровню, например:

<table style="... global table styling">
  <tbody>
 <tr>
   <td style="td styling;td dv style">
     .. nothing special
 </tr>
  </tbody>
</table>

Есть ли программы, которые могут это сделать?Или есть более простой способ сделать это?У меня в основном есть блог на Wordpress.com, который выглядит красиво, в Live Writer из-за некоторых пользовательских стилей, но как только я публикую его, он удаляет блок стилей.В качестве теста я прошел вручную, сделал некоторые из вышеперечисленных, и это работает, это просто безумно больно и подвержено ошибкам.

Ответы [ 3 ]

1 голос
/ 21 сентября 2010

если вы находитесь на wordpress.com, я не думаю, что вы можете контролировать CSS или любой другой файл.

Вы должны разместить свой собственный блог на wordpress.org, чтобы настроить свою тему.

1 голос
/ 24 сентября 2010

Итак, я нашел онлайн решение под названием "emogrifier"

Хорошо работает, все, что вам нужно сделать, это ввести css, затем ввести html, и он выведет встроенные стили.

0 голосов
/ 20 сентября 2010

Существует плагин Art Direction , который позволяет добавлять пользовательские CSS для каждого поста.Если вы используете этот стиль на нескольких разных страницах, вы должны добавить стили в глобальную таблицу стилей.

...